Solution for 4k^2+8k-2=0 equation:


Simplifying
4k2 + 8k + -2 = 0

Reorder the terms:
-2 + 8k + 4k2 = 0

Solving
-2 + 8k + 4k2 = 0

Solving for variable 'k'.

Factor out the Greatest Common Factor (GCF), '2'.
2(-1 + 4k + 2k2) = 0

Ignore the factor 2.

Subproblem 1

Set the factor '(-1 + 4k + 2k2)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ying -1 + 4k + 2k2 = 0 Solving -1 + 4k + 2k2 = 0 Begin completing the square. Divide all terms by 2 the coefficient of the squared term: Divide each side by '2'. -0.5 + 2k + k2 = 0 Move the constant term to the right: Add '0.5' to each side of the equation. -0.5 + 2k + 0.5 + k2 = 0 + 0.5 Reorder the terms: -0.5 + 0.5 + 2k + k2 = 0 + 0.5 Combine like terms: -0.5 + 0.5 = 0.0 0.0 + 2k + k2 = 0 + 0.5 2k + k2 = 0 + 0.5 Combine like terms: 0 + 0.5 = 0.5 2k + k2 = 0.5 The k term is 2k. Take half its coefficient (1). Square it (1) and add it to both sides. Add '1' to each side of the equation. 2k + 1 + k2 = 0.5 + 1 Reorder the terms: 1 + 2k + k2 = 0.5 + 1 Combine like terms: 0.5 + 1 = 1.5 1 + 2k + k2 = 1.5 Factor a perfect square on the left side: (k + 1)(k + 1) = 1.5 Calculate the square root of the right side: 1.224744871 Break this problem into two subproblems by setting (k + 1) equal to 1.224744871 and -1.224744871.

Subproblem 1

k + 1 = 1.224744871 Simplifying k + 1 = 1.224744871 Reorder the terms: 1 + k = 1.224744871 Solving 1 + k = 1.224744871 Solving for variable 'k'. Move all terms containing k to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-1' to each side of the equation. 1 + -1 + k = 1.224744871 + -1 Combine like terms: 1 + -1 = 0 0 + k = 1.224744871 + -1 k = 1.224744871 + -1 Combine like terms: 1.224744871 + -1 = 0.224744871 k = 0.224744871 Simplifying k = 0.224744871

Subproblem 2

k + 1 = -1.224744871 Simplifying k + 1 = -1.224744871 Reorder the terms: 1 + k = -1.224744871 Solving 1 + k = -1.224744871 Solving for variable 'k'. Move all terms containing k to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-1' to each side of the equation. 1 + -1 + k = -1.224744871 + -1 Combine like terms: 1 + -1 = 0 0 + k = -1.224744871 + -1 k = -1.224744871 + -1 Combine like terms: -1.224744871 + -1 = -2.224744871 k = -2.224744871 Simplifying k = -2.224744871

Solution

The solution to the problem is based on the solutions from the subproblems. k = {0.224744871, -2.224744871}

Solution

k = {0.224744871, -2.224744871}
